EN 1.6554 Steel vs. ACI-ASTM CN7MS Steel

Both EN 1.6554 steel and ACI-ASTM CN7MS steel are iron alloys. They have 53%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(5,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.6554 steel and the bottom bar is ACI-ASTM CN7MS steel.
